1 Introduction to Research Design

2 What Is Research Design? The structure of research

3 Elements of a Design l Observations or measures l Treatments or programs l Groups l Assignment to group l Time

4 Observations or Measures Symbolized with an "O". Subscripts are used to distinguish different combinations of measures only if this is necessary.

5 Treatments or Programs Symbolized with an "X". Subscripts are used to indicate different programs or combinations of programs.

6 Groups Each group of interest on its own line.

7 Assignment to Groups R = Random assignment N = Nonequivalent groups C = Assignment by cutoff

8 Time Left-to-right movement denotes the passage of time.
